The creator of a petition trying to get Kim Kardashian and her family removed from E! has been receiving death threats.
The "No More Kardashian" petition asking E! to quit keeping up with the Kardashians has gotten over 100,000 signatures now, but it definitely doesn't have everyone's support.
In fact, some Kardashian fans have been krazy enough to launch death threats at 41-year-old Cyndy Snider, the woman behind the petition. So it seems that Kardashian fans are taking a page from Beliebers in order to fight the Kardashian boycott currently going on.
Sadly celebrity-related death threats are getting more common these days—the anonymity of the Internet makes it possible for people to threaten the lives of others without having to worry too much about repercussions. However, the Kim Kardashian fans making the death threats might want to watch out; earlier this month, police did investigate one Justin Bieber fan who made death threats against his ex Caitlin Beadles on Tumblr.
But Cyndy Snider isn't the only one going through a tough time after going after Kim Kardashian. Jonathan Jaxson, a man who claimed to be Kim's former publicist, posted a bunch of suicidal tweets Wednesday night. Jaxson has been promoting a book and making headlines for his claims that Kim's wedding was a sham, but Kim tried to put the kibosh on his moneymaking scheme by suing him for breach of contract. Luckily a friend got Jaxson help after reading his suicidal tweets about how he can't win his battle against Kim, but it kind of sounds like he might have been receiving from pretty bad threats himself.
